element的多层遮盖层嵌套问题
element的多层遮盖层嵌套问题
问题一:层级混乱
描述:使用element组件进行多层遮盖层嵌套时,往往会出现层级混乱的问题。
解释:当多个遮盖层同时存在时,如果未正确设置其层级关系,会导致部分遮盖层被其他遮盖层覆盖,无法正常显示。
解决方法:通过设置z-index属性来调整元素的层级关系,确保遮盖层正确显示。
问题二:滚动条被遮挡
描述:在使用element的遮盖层嵌套过程中,可能会出现滚动条被遮挡的问题。
解释:当遮盖层的位置固定或绝对定位时,会导致滚动条被遮挡,用户无法正常滚动内容区域。
解决方法:通过设置合适的CSS属性,使遮盖层不影响滚动条的显示,如overflow属性设置为auto或scroll。
问题三:事件穿透
描述:在多层遮盖层嵌套中,可能会出现事件穿透的问题。
解释:当多个遮盖层同时存在且有点击事件时,下方的遮盖层可能会接收到上方遮盖层的点击事件,导致用户无法正常操作。
解决方法:使用CSS属性pointer-events,设置下方遮盖层为none,以阻止上方遮盖层的事件穿透。
问题四:遮盖层无法关闭
描述:在嵌套多层遮盖层时,可能会出现遮盖层无法关闭的问题。
解释:由于多层嵌套可能会导致关闭事件无法正确触发或传递,造成遮盖层无法关闭。
element表格横向滚动条
解决方法:针对每个遮盖层的关闭事件,确保事件绑定正确、传递正确,使遮盖层能够正常关闭。
问题五:页面性能下降
描述:当嵌套多层遮盖层时,可能会导致页面性能下降。
解释:多层遮盖层的嵌套会增加DOM元素的数量,导致渲染性能下降,页面交互变慢。
解决方法:尽量避免多层遮盖层的嵌套,合理使用遮盖层,减少DOM元素的数量,优化页面性能。
以上是element的多层遮盖层嵌套问题的一些相关问题及解决方法。通过合理的设置层级关系、CSS属性和事件绑定,可以避免或解决这些问题,提升页面的用户体验和性能表现。
当然,还有一些其他与element的多层遮盖层嵌套相关的问题:
问题六:滚动条闪动
描述:在使用element的遮盖层嵌套时,可能会出现滚动条闪动的问题。
解释:当遮盖层的显示与隐藏频繁交替时,可能导致滚动条在隐藏和显示之间闪烁,影响用户体验。
解决方法:使用CSS属性overflow-y,将滚动条的显示方式改为始终显示或隐藏,避免滚动条的闪动。
问题七:遮盖层位置错乱
描述:在多层遮盖层嵌套过程中,可能会出现遮盖层位置错乱的问题。
解释:由于多层遮盖层的嵌套可能会导致定位方式、相对位置等问题,使得遮盖层的位置不符合预期。
解决方法:通过调整遮盖层的定位方式、使用正确的定位参考对象,确保遮盖层的位置正确显示。
问题八:遮盖层触发其他样式
描述:在多层遮盖层嵌套时,可能会出现遮盖层触发其他样式的问题。
解释:由于多个遮盖层的嵌套,可能会影响其他元素的样式表现,使其显示异常。
解决方法:通过调整遮盖层的层级关系、适当使用CSS属性如opacity等,确保遮盖层不会影响其他元素的样式。
问题九:动画效果冲突
描述:在多层遮盖层嵌套过程中,可能会出现动画效果冲突的问题。
解释:当多个遮盖层同时存在时,其中一个遮盖层的动画效果可能会与其他遮盖层的动画效果冲突,导致不符合预期。
解决方法:通过合理的动画效果设计、设置合适的动画时机和延时,避免动画效果冲突,保证其正常运行。
以上是element的多层遮盖层嵌套问题的一些相关问题及解决方法。通过注意这些问题,并根据实际情况进行调整和优化,可以提高页面的稳定性和用户体验。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。